ANDREAS KARKAVITSAS
'Andreas Karkavitsas' (Lechaina, Greece 1866 - Amarousi October 10, 1922) was a Greek writer. He studied medicine and, as an army doctor, travelled to many villages, where he recorded traditions and legends.
